  • U Kentucky Establishes Committee to Explore and Make Recommendations on AI

    The University of Kentucky (UK) has established the ADVANCE (Advancing Data utilization for Value in Academia for National and Campuswide Excellence) Committee to study AI and ChatGPT and make recommendations for their use on campus. Led by Provost Robert DiPaola, the committee includes a broad range of representatives from academic and administrative areas, according to a release. 06/15/2023

    More IHEs Paid Ransoms in 2022, Even As Average Recovery Cost Fell, Sophos Research Finds

    Nearly eight out of 10 higher ed organizations surveyed for Sophos’ 2023 State of Ransomware Report said they were hit by ransomware last year — a 23% increase from the previous year’s results — making education the most-attacked sector in 2022. 06/08/2023
